4.12?Java-based container configuration
4.12.1?Basic concepts: @Bean and @Configuration
The central artifacts in Spring’s new Java-configuration support are?@Configuration-annotated classes and?@Bean -annotated methods.
The?@Bean ?annotation is used to indicate that a method instantiates, configures and initializes a new object to be managed by the Spring IoC container. For those familiar with Spring's?<beans/>?XML configuration the?@Bean?annotation plays the same role as the?<bean/>?element. You can use?@Bean?annotated methods with any Spring?@Component, however, they are most often used with?@Configuration?beans.
Annotating a class with?@Configuration??indicates that its primary purpose is as a source of bean definitions. Furthermore,?@Configuration?classes allow inter-bean dependencies to be defined by simply calling other?@Bean?methods in the same class. The simplest possible?@Configuration?class would read as follows:
@Configurationpublic class AppConfig { ?
? ?@Bean
? ?public MyService myService() { ? ? ? ?
? ? ? ? ?return new MyServiceImpl();
? ?}
}
The?AppConfig?class above would be equivalent to the following Spring?<beans/>?XML:
<beans><bean?id="myService"?class="com.acme.services.MyServiceImpl"/> </beans>The?@Bean?and?@Configuration?annotations will be discussed in depth in the sections below. First, however, we'll cover the various ways of creating a spring container using Java-based configuration.
4.12.2 AnnotationConfigApplicationContext
The sections below document Spring’s?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ext, new in Spring 3.0. This versatile?ApplicationContext?implementation is capable of accepting not only?@Configuration?classes as input, but also plain?@Component?classes and classes annotated with JSR-330 metadata.
When?@Configuration?classes are provided as input, the?@Configuration?class itself is registered as a bean definition, and all declared?@Bean?methods within the class are also registered as bean definitions.
When?@Component?and JSR-330 classes are provided, they are registered as bean definitions, and it is assumed that DI metadata such as?@Autowired?or?@Inject?are used within those classes where necessary.
Simple construction
In much the same way that Spring XML files are used as input when instantiating a?ClassPathXmlApplicationContext,?@Configuration?classes may be used as input when instantiating an?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ext. This allows for completely XML-free usage of the Spring container:
public static void main(String[] args) {? ?ApplicationContext ctx = new AnnotationConfigApplicationContext(AppConfig.class);//如上所定義的AppConfig class 文件
? ?MyService myService = ctx.getBean(MyService.class);
? ?myService.doStuff();
}
As mentioned above,?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ext?is not limited to working only with?@Configuration?classes. Any?@Component?or JSR-330 annotated class may be supplied as input to the constructor. For example:
public static void main(String[] args) {? ?ApplicationContext ctx = new AnnotationConfigApplicationContext(MyServiceImpl.class, Dependency1.class, Dependency2.class);
? ?MyService myService = ctx.getBean(MyService.class);
? ?myService.doStuff();
}
The above assumes that?MyServiceImpl,?Dependency1?and?Dependency2?use Spring dependency injection annotations such as?@Autowired.
Building the container programmatically using register(Class<?>…)
An?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ext?may be instantiated using a no-arg constructor and then configured using the?register()?method. This approach is particularly useful when programmatically building an?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ext.

A?WebApplicationContext?variant of?AnnotationConfigApplicationContext?is available with?AnnotationConfigWebApplicationContext. This implementation may be used when configuring the Spring?ContextLoaderListener?servlet listener, Spring MVC?DispatcherServlet, etc. What follows is a?web.xml?snippet that configures a typical Spring MVC web application. Note the use of the?contextClass?context-param and init-param:
